Transaction 3561385138e8b0493d504c269fd00c73beedf43667643f4bbb744a80da8e4e6b

1 Input
2 Outputs
  • 3561385138e8b0493d504c269fd00c73beedf43667643f4bbb744a80da8e4e6b:0
  • value  15811291
    address  12Ah2tpEqqenv5bRUQcXzYPHyxEypgNu3L
  • 3561385138e8b0493d504c269fd00c73beedf43667643f4bbb744a80da8e4e6b:1
  • value  1334960
    address  32t1H7JYvCdgdVaueDZ3TPxDdHbARqPFjg